I have an NEC VT470. The projector shut down after the lamp finished. When I replaced the lamp and pressed the start button, the projector does not come back on.

Some of the NEC units have a standby status when the lamplife has exceeded its safe limit, the unit I had needed the off button pressing for up to 20 seconds to reset the lamplife and allow the unit to be switched back on. There should be info for this in your manual.

I have a NEC VT470 Projector. The power light is steady orange and the status light blinks red 6 times.

steady orange means projector in standby mode
red light 6 times is a lamp error.
either the lamp is old and wont start up or the ballast power pcb is not working.
can you hear the sparking of the high voltage trying to strike the lamp.
if you can then the lamp may be dodgy.
can you borrow one to test it out

Nec vt470 lamp does not come on. replace lamp, when turned on status light turns red and get 3 beeps. lamp does not come on.

If you replaced the lamp already, chances are the ballast is defective. When you power on the projector with the power button you should see a flicker of light in the lens, or an electrical sound. If you don't you ballast is bad.

I have replaced bulbs in 3 different types of NEC projectors: a silver, older model thta uses a VT60LP bulb, model VT595 and VT470. The lamp will still not work - the power and status light just continue...

I had the same issue, what I figured out was that I never removed the lamp door correctly, causing a small plastic piece to break off. To see if this is also your problem, inspect the back of the lamp door, top right corner, if it seems a rectangular plastic piece is missing, thats the problem. It presses in a small button nearby the lamp to let the projector know it's safe to power on.

NEC VT47 Blink Sequence but not comming up.

If it is a lamp error try this:
When the lamp exceeds 2100 hoursof service, the projector cannot turn on and the manu is not displayed. Do the following:
For VT670/VT470 Press the help button on the remote control for a minimum of ten seconds.
For VT570/VT47 Press and hold the power and the exit buttons on the remote control simultaneously for a minimum of ten seconds. When the lamp time clock is reset to zero, the lamp indicator goes out. Hope this helps! :]

NEC VT 470 projector won't work at all

Try pressing the HELP button. Don't release and press the power button. The LED lights should blink. Release then try to power on again.
